Daratumumab, Bortezomib, Lenalidomide, and Dexamethasone for Multiple Myeloma
The addition of subcutaneous daratumumab to bortezomib, lenalidomide, and dexamethasone therapy and to lenalidomide maintenance therapy had a significant benefit on progression-free survival among patients with multiple myeloma.
